WebApr 13, 2024 · To care for a child who’s been bitten, wash the area with soap and water, and apply a cold compress. If the bite has broken the skin, the same care is … WebTo prevent biting from occurring, parents and caretakers should set limits before young children play together. Rules should be simple, like taking turns and sharing. Parents and caretakers should consistently enforce these rules. *Catch children being good. WebIf a child bites more when he is tired or hungry, change the schedule for the day. Offer a mid-morning snack, or move lunchtime up. Arrange for an earlier nap time, or a calm, quiet activity. If you think a child is biting to get attention or from stress, spend some extra time with that child. Try reading a book together, playing together, or ...
